The
Bear Trax 100 Hare Scrambles scheduled for July 24, 2011 is postponed to a
later date.
We started advertising the event in early April but it didn't reach the
right media until this last week when Brad put it on Wisconsinmx forum.
Thanks to Brad things are really looking up. My computer and phone have been
constantly busy ever since.
With the deadline for pre-registration on July 15, 2011 and the confusion it
has caused we have carefully considered the options and decided to postpone
the races. From all the questions I have been reciving, I see there are
several things that will need to be changed.
Matt Burton from the D-14 area has come up with an idea that could include
the AA, - A, - and B classes by making this a 2 day event, with a seperate
cash purse for each day. We will run the 3 races on Saturday for the 125cc
and larger bikes and 3 races on Sunday for the AA, - A - and B classes. The
Sunday races will run with a handicap so all the riders have an equal chance
of winning.
The pre-registration checks I have received will be marked VOID and returned
to the riders.
I would like to thank all you riders for your interest in these races.
Hare Scrambles are still alive and well. Please "Bear" with me.
